對于織夢幻燈片,相信很多朋友跟我一樣遇到不少問題,下面我跟大家講講織夢幻燈片的些技巧方法:
先說下原理吧:
幻燈片的工作原理就是將數(shù)據(jù)和模板目錄下的default/images/bcastr3.swf進行數(shù)據(jù)交互,獲得圖片展示效果。先貼上代碼,大家可以看一下。
	   <script language=’javascript’>
	linkarr = new Array();
	picarr = new Array();
	textarr = new Array();
	var swf_width=280;
	var swf_height=192;
	//文字顏色|文字位置|文字背景顏色|文字背景透明度|按鍵文字顏色|按鍵默認顏色|按鍵當前顏色|自動播放時間|圖片過渡效果|是否顯示按鈕|打開方式
	var configtg=’0xffffff|0|0x3FA61F|5|0xffffff|0xC5DDBC|0×000033|2|3|1|_blank’;
	var files = “”;
	var links = “”;
	var texts = “”;
	//這里設(shè)置調(diào)用標記
	{dede:arclist flag=’f’ row=’5′}
	linkarr[[field:global.autoindex/]] = “[field:arcurl/]“; //文章路徑
	picarr[[field:global.autoindex/]]  = “[field:litpic/]“; //文章縮略圖
	textarr[[field:global.autoindex/]] = “[field:title function='html2text(@me)'/]“; //文章標題
	{/dede:arclist}
	for(i=1;i<picarr.length;i++){
	if(files==”") files = picarr[i];
	else files += “|”+picarr[i];
	}
	for(i=1;i<linkarr.length;i++){
	if(links==”") links = linkarr[i];
	else links += “|”+linkarr[i];
	}
	for(i=1;i<textarr.length;i++){
	if(texts==”") texts = textarr[i];
	else texts += “|”+textarr[i];
	}
	document.write(‘<object classid=”clsid:d27cdb6e-ae6d-11cf-96b8-444553540000″ codebase=”http://fpdownload.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,0,0″ width=”‘+ swf_width +’” height=”‘+ swf_height +’”>’);
	document.write(‘<param name=”movie” value=”{dede:global.cfg_templeturl /}/default/images/bcastr3.swf”><param name=”quality” value=”high”>’);
	document.write(‘<param name=”menu” value=”false”><param name=wmode value=”opaque”>’);
	document.write(‘<param name=”FlashVars” value=”bcastr_file=’+files+’&bcastr_link=’+links+’&bcastr_title=’+texts+’&bcastr_config=’+configtg+’”>’);
	document.write(‘<embed src=”{dede:global.cfg_templeturl /}/default/images/bcastr3.swf” wmode=”opaque” FlashVars=”bcastr_file=’+files+’&bcastr_link=’+links+’&bcastr_title=’+texts+’&bcastr_config=’+configtg+’&menu=”false” quality=”high” width=”‘+ swf_width +’” height=”‘+ swf_height +’” type=”application/x-shockwave-flash” pluginspage=”http://www.macromedia.com/go/getflashplayer” />’); document.write(‘</object>’);
	</script>
這是織夢(dedecms)默認的幻燈片,如果進行修改的話:大家可以參照官方給出的注釋進行修改。
	//文字顏色|文字位置|文字背景顏色|文字背景透明度|按鍵文字顏色|按鍵默認顏色|按鍵當前顏色|自動播放時間|圖片過渡效果|是否顯示按鈕|打開方式
	var configtg=’0xffffff|0|0x3FA61F|5|0xffffff|0xC5DDBC|0×000033|2|3|1|_blank’;
	希望對大家有幫助
新聞熱點
疑難解答
圖片精選